Uniform definition of Aravallis accepted by Supreme Court will be catastrophic for India’s oldest mountain range

Supreme Court’s acceptance of a 100-metre elevation rule for defining the Aravallis will strip protection from over 90% of the range, opening it to mining. Experts warn this could worsen desertification, deplete groundwater, destroy biodiversity, and threaten food and water security in India.
